2

我认为 FS 代表文件系统,但我不知道 BLK 代表什么。不仅如此,pci层级参数背后的含义是什么。即当我看到 HD(1,MBR,0x0003B) 时,“1”、“MBR”是什么,看起来是一个地址,代表什么?

这是我在 UEFI shell 中查看的映射表:

Mapping table
  FS0: Alias(s):HD21a0e0b:;BLK1:
      PciRoot(0x0)/Pci(0x1D,0x0)/USB(0x0,0x0)/USB(0x4,0x0)/HD(1,MBR,0x0003B)
  FS1: Alias(s):HD23a0a1:;BLK4:
      PciRoot(0x0)/Pci(0x1F,0x2)/Sata(0x0,0x0,0x0)/HD(1,MBR,0x00000000,0x3F)
 BLK3: Alias(s):
      PciRoot(0x0)/Pci(0x1F,0x2)/Sata(0x0,0x0,0x0)
 BLK0: Alias(s):
      PciRoot(0x0)/Pci(0x1D,0x0)/USB(0x0,0x0)/USB(0x4,0x0)
 BLK2: Alias(s):
      PciRoot(0x0)/Pci(0x1D,0x0)/USB(0x0,0x0)/USB(0x4,0x0)/HD(2,MBR,0x0003B)

我猜BLK是可用的端口,FS是插入这些端口的物理东西。看起来一旦某个东西插入到 BLK 中,它就会变成 FS,但仍保留其 BLK 值。ig FS0=BLK1

4

1 回答 1

3

根据archwiki

  • fsX方法filesystem
  • blkX意味着block devicedata storage device

MBR应该是什么意思Master Boot Record

HD应该是什么意思Hard Drive

1可能意味着Primary2 Secondary Partition

MBR 之后的十六进制数字可以是设备签名或磁盘标识符。或者可能是该设备对重要信息的偏移。

可能有助于进一步的链接:

于 2014-06-23T19:10:59.783 回答